**Ticket VLT-providence: Vault locked during pagination rollout**

While shipping cursor-based pagination for the Lanternfeld public REST API, the Providence secrets vault auto-sealed after three failed unseal attempts. New team members: pagination changes are safe to merge, but the API signing keys live in that vault, so releases are blocked until it is reopened. To unseal, an operator must enter the recovery passphrase recorded directly below this line.

vault phrase of tajeg-tageg = pelix-druix-holius-briael-zorwyn-frawyn-fraox-norok-drueth-aldiel

## Support

Running your plugin behind the Harlowe load balancer? Make sure you implement the `/healthz` endpoint — the balancer pings it every ten seconds, and anything slower than 500ms gets marked unhealthy and pulled from rotation. A common gotcha: don't hit your database in the health check, or a slow query will take your whole plugin offline. Lightweight liveness only, please. The docs have a sample implementation for most frameworks. If you're still seeing flapping instances after that, drop us a line.

escalation mailbox, bafog-fafog: ulador@paliqlabs.internal

## Read-Replica Lag Alarm

New folks: the ReplicaLagHigh alarm covers the Ostrel reporting replicas. It fires when lag exceeds 90 seconds for five minutes. Most triggers come from the nightly Bramwell export job, which is expected and auto-resolves. Do not fail over the replica yourself — that requires the data-platform lead's approval and a change ticket. If the alarm persists past 20 minutes with no export running, write to the platform inbox.

billing contact of yahip-yadup = eliax.druix@zemvarworks.corp

# Document Transport — Gallery Labels

Scope: printed and mounted labels for the new Averline Gallery opening.

Packing: flat cartons only, corner guards, no stacking above two high. Label each carton with gallery zone code. Log counts in the transport register before sealing.

Carrier: Roukwell Express, insured run. Shift lead signs the manifest; no partial loads. Damaged cartons are quarantined, not shipped.

Release: cartons leave only against the hand-over instruction stated below.

dispatch memo: the silok lamdor courier leaves the pramir tamix julax ledger at gate 7050 under passcode 555680